#YHW1905. 渔获重量优化

渔获重量优化

渔获重量优化

题目描述

nn 艘渔船依次返回沈家门渔港,每艘渔船有一个渔获重量 AiA_i。港口调度中心记录了两个下标 p,q(p<q)p, q(p < q),分别表示第 pp 艘和第 qq 艘渔船。

你可以选择任意一个区间 [L,R][L, R] 并将这个范围内的渔船渔获重量 ALARA_L \sim A_R 从小到大重新登记。

求选择一个区间重新登记后 AqApA_q - A_p 的值最大可以是多少。

输入格式

输入的第一行包含三个整数 n,p,qn, p, q,相邻两个整数之间使用一个空格分隔。

第二行包含 nn 个整数,分别表示 A1,A2,,AnA_1, A_2, \cdots, A_n,相邻两个整数之间使用一个空格分隔。

输出格式

输出一行,包含一个整数表示 AqApA_q - A_p 的最大值。

输入输出样例 #1

输入 #1

5 1 4
4 5 3 3 1

输出 #1

3

说明/提示

对于 20%20\% 的评测用例,n100,Ai200n \le 100 ,A_i \le 200

对于 40%40\% 的评测用例,n2000,Ai3000n \le 2000 ,A_i \le 3000

对于所有评测用例,$1 \le p \le q \le n \le 2 \times 10^5,1 \le A_i \le 10^6$。